Springboot+Vue打造高效房屋租赁系统源码解析
版权申诉
84 浏览量
更新于2024-11-25
收藏 74.54MB ZIP 举报
资源摘要信息:"基于Springboot+Vue的房屋租赁系统毕业源码案例设计.zip"
知识点一:Spring Boot框架
Spring Boot是由Pivotal团队提供的全新框架,其设计目的是简化新Spring应用的初始搭建以及开发过程。Spring Boot提供了大量默认配置,帮助开发者快速启动和运行基于Spring的应用程序。此外,Spring Boot可以轻松创建独立的、生产级别的基于Spring框架的应用,它使用“约定优于配置”的原则,减少开发者的配置工作。Spring Boot可以集成大量的第三方库,如数据库访问技术、消息队列、缓存等,极大地简化了操作。在本系统中,Spring Boot框架用于快速构建后端服务,处理业务逻辑,实现与前端的交互。
知识点二:Vue.js框架
Vue.js是一个渐进式JavaScript框架,用于构建用户界面。Vue的设计目的是通过尽可能简单的API实现响应式的数据绑定和组合的视图组件。Vue的核心库只关注视图层,易于上手,同时它也可以自底向上逐层应用。Vue.js通过其灵活的设计,可以将Vue嵌入到复杂的单页应用程序中。在本系统中,Vue.js被用于构建动态的用户界面,提供交互式体验。
知识点三:MySQL数据库
MySQL是一个流行的开源关系数据库管理系统(RDBMS),它使用结构化查询语言(SQL)进行数据库管理。MySQL运行在多种操作系统上,支持大型数据库和大规模并发访问,具有高性能、高可靠性和易用性等特点。在本系统中,MySQL负责存储和管理房屋租赁的相关数据,如房源信息、用户信息、租赁合同等。
知识点四:前后端分离
前后端分离是一种软件架构模式,它将传统的Web开发模式拆分为前端开发和后端开发。前端主要负责页面的展示和与用户的交互,后端则负责业务逻辑处理、数据存取等。这种架构提高了前后端开发的独立性,使得前后端可以并行开发,提升了开发效率,同时也降低了系统维护的复杂度。在本系统中,前端使用Vue.js,后端则基于Spring Boot框架,两者通过API接口进行数据交互。
知识点五:系统设计与开发流程
系统设计与开发流程是软件开发中的关键步骤,它涉及需求分析、系统设计、实现、测试、部署和维护等多个阶段。一个良好的设计流程可以确保软件质量和项目的进度。本系统遵循了软件设计开发流程,确保了房屋租赁系统的功能完善和系统友好性。
知识点六:数据规范与数据验证
在信息系统中,数据的准确性和可靠性至关重要。数据规范和数据验证是指在数据输入系统之前,通过一系列规则和标准对数据进行校验,确保数据的质量。本系统通过设计有效的数据输入规则,确保了数据的准确性,从而降低了系统数据错误率,提高了数据的可靠性。
知识点七:开发技术引流
在本系统的标签中提到了一系列的开发技术,包括Java、Spring Boot、Vue.js、MySQL等。这些技术都是当前IT行业中广泛使用且非常流行的开发工具。Java是一种强大的编程语言,适合企业级应用开发;Spring Boot简化了基于Spring的应用开发;Vue.js则适合构建用户界面;MySQL是广泛使用的数据库技术。这些技术的组合使用,可以使开发者在构建Web应用时更加高效和便捷。
知识点八:系统文件结构
在压缩包中提供的文件结构列表中,包含了manualType.properties、系统.txt、springboot008基于Springboot+Vue的房屋租赁系统毕业源码案例设计等文件。manualType.properties可能是项目中使用的属性配置文件,系统.txt可能包含了项目的详细说明或使用手册,而springboot008基于Springboot+Vue的房屋租赁系统毕业源码案例设计则是整个项目的源码文件,包含了系统设计的所有代码和资源。这些文件为开发者提供了深入了解和部署系统的机会。
2024-07-14 上传
2024-12-04 上传
2024-04-20 上传
2024-04-27 上传
2024-02-15 上传
2024-04-27 上传
2024-04-20 上传
2024-11-06 上传
2024-11-08 上传
枫蜜柚子茶
- 粉丝: 9019
- 资源: 5351
最新资源
- CoreOS部署神器:configdrive_creator脚本详解
- 探索CCR-Studio.github.io: JavaScript的前沿实践平台
- RapidMatter:Web企业架构设计即服务应用平台
- 电影数据整合:ETL过程与数据库加载实现
- R语言文本分析工作坊资源库详细介绍
- QML小程序实现风车旋转动画教程
- Magento小部件字段验证扩展功能实现
- Flutter入门项目:my_stock应用程序开发指南
- React项目引导:快速构建、测试与部署
- 利用物联网智能技术提升设备安全
- 软件工程师校招笔试题-编程面试大学完整学习计划
- Node.js跨平台JavaScript运行时环境介绍
- 使用护照js和Google Outh的身份验证器教程
- PHP基础教程:掌握PHP编程语言
- Wheel:Vim/Neovim高效缓冲区管理与导航插件
- 在英特尔NUC5i5RYK上安装并优化Kodi运行环境